Buying Used Cutting Tools : A Buyer's Guide

Venturing into the area of used cutting tools can be a smart move for companies looking to reduce expenditures, but it requires careful evaluation . Review the implement's provenance; ask for maintenance records . Verify for obvious wear and confirm the manufacturer is established. Ultimately, contrast rates from several sellers before finalizing your investment.

Lathe Tool Holder Varieties & Applications

A selection of turning cutting clamp types existing reflects a substantial array of machining applications. Common seen mounts feature live working holders, which allow working correction during processing; static tool mounts, providing a fixed location; and angled cutting holders, perfect for difficult detail machining. Specific uses specify the best mount choice, taking factors like material shape, needed surface, and tool extension.
